Grinding Media in Ball Mills for Mineral Processing

·Corrosive wear is greatly dominant in wet grinding when using ferrous grinding media and is responsible for up to 50% of ferrous grinding media consumption Despite the widely accepted phenomenon that wet grinding is a fertile environment for corrosion wear regardless of the chromium content of the balls studies to verify its importance are


PDF Morphology and wear of high chromium and

·High chromium balls are recognized as better grinding media in terms of wear rates than forged steel balls which are conventional grinding media in the milling process of iron ore
